Skip to content
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o
  1. ioBroker Community Home
  2. Deutsch
  3. ioBroker Allgemein
  4. IoBroker und Stau- / Verkehrsinformationen

NEWS

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    8.1k

  • Monatsrückblick – September 2025
    BluefoxB
    Bluefox
    13
    1
    1.9k

  • Neues Video "KI im Smart Home" - ioBroker plus n8n
    BluefoxB
    Bluefox
    15
    1
    2.1k

IoBroker und Stau- / Verkehrsinformationen

Geplant Angeheftet Gesperrt Verschoben ioBroker Allgemein
119 Beiträge 48 Kommentatoren 31.9k Aufrufe 24 Watching
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• D Offline
    D Offline
    DiJaexxl
    schrieb am zuletzt editiert von
    #66

    @ruhr70:

    OK, gar nicht drauf geachtet… Eine Aufgabe für @Homoran 😉

    Dann das Skript, welches ich hier aus dem Forum kopiert hatte:

    ! function currentDate() { var d = new Date(); return new Date(d.getFullYear(), d.getMonth(), d.getDate()); } function addTime(strTime) { var time = strTime.split(':'); var d = currentDate(); d.setHours(time[0]); d.setMinutes(time[1]); d.setSeconds(time[2]); return d; } function isTimeInRange(strLower, strUpper) { var now = new Date(); var lower = addTime(strLower); var upper = addTime(strUpper); var inRange = false; if (upper > lower) { // opens and closes in same day inRange = (now >= lower && now <= upper) ? true : false; } else { // closes in the following day inRange = (now >= upper && now <= lower) ? false : true; } return inRange; } ! `

    Hallo,

    das ist nun das Globale Script für???

    Gruss aus Bensberg

    Dirk

    1 Antwort Letzte Antwort
    0
    • FeuersturmF Online
      FeuersturmF Online
      Feuersturm
      schrieb am zuletzt editiert von
      #67

      @Sven2013:

      Hey Leute,

      vielen Dank für das tolle Skript. Es funktioniert auf Anhieb.

      Kann ich mir auch die Route auf einer Karte anzeigen lassen um zu sehen wo Google mich her schickt?

      Gruß Sven `

      Die Google Maps Embed API (https://developers.google.com/maps/docu … uide?hl=de) biete im "Modus „Directions“" die Möglichkeit sich eine Route in die Google-Maps Karte darstellen zu lassen.

      In der Google Cloud Platform https://console.cloud.google.com/apis/dashboard muss die API "Google Maps Embed API" aktiviert werden, um diese Funktionalität nutzen zu können.

      In einem iframe kann dann der Link, in welchem der eigene API-Key noch eingefügt werden muss, eingefügt werden. Ein lauffähiges Beispiel findet man in der Beschreibung der Embed API:

      https://www.google.com/maps/embed/v1/directions?key=YOUR_API_KEY&origin=Oslo+Norway&destination=Telemark+Norway&avoid=tolls|highways
      

      Wenn du jetzt diesen Link mit den Parametern bestückst, welche auch im Skript verwendet werden solltest du die Route sehen, welche im Skript berechnet wird.

      1 Antwort Letzte Antwort
      0
      • N Offline
        N Offline
        nyandog
        schrieb am zuletzt editiert von
        #68

        Hallo!

        Leider scheint das Script bei mir irgendwie nicht zu funktionieren. Ich habe die Wegpunkte und meinen Google API-Key eingetragen und bekomme im Log folgendes zurück:

        ` > 11:29:40.310 [info] javascript.0 Start javascript script.js.stau.stau_zur_arbeit

        11:29:40.310 [info] javascript.0 script.js.stau.stau_zur_arbeit: registered 0 subscriptions and 1 schedule

        11:29:41.693 [info] javascript.0 script.js.stau.stau_zur_arbeit: Kein gültiger Status Google Maps: NOT_FOUND `

        Wenn ich die URL direkt im Browser eingebe, bekomme ich folgendes zurück:
        ` > {

        "geocoded_waypoints" : [

        {

        "geocoder_status" : "ZERO_RESULTS"

        },

        {

        "geocoder_status" : "ZERO_RESULTS"

        },

        {

        "geocoder_status" : "ZERO_RESULTS"

        }

        ],

        "routes" : [],

        "status" : "NOT_FOUND"

        } `

        Am Script selbst habe ich nichts verändert. Hat jemand eine Idee, woran es liegen könnte?

        1 Antwort Letzte Antwort
        0
        • E Offline
          E Offline
          eXTreMe
          schrieb am zuletzt editiert von
          #69

          wenns nur ums simple karte und route in vis einblenden geht ohne API spielerei:

          • einfach in googlemaps eine route abfragen

          • dann oben links auf den menü button (der mit den 3 horizontalen strichen)

          • dann auf "Karte teilen oder einbetten" klicken und schon hat man einen link den man in VIS als iFrame einbinden kann.
            2665_googlemaps.png

          das ganze sieht dann in meiner vis z.b. so aus:

          Baustellen und Staus/Unfälle werden wie man es von googlemaps gewohnt ist eingeblendet
          2665_maps_vis.png

          1 Antwort Letzte Antwort
          0
          • N Offline
            N Offline
            Nebulus
            schrieb am zuletzt editiert von
            #70

            Hallo ich brauche mal Deine Hilfe,

            ich bekomme es mit der Anzeige nicht hin, bei mir wird nur ein leeres Feld angezeigt
            1191_iframe.jpg

            <size size="85">Pi1: Raspberrymatic / Pi2: Jessie, ioBroker Amazon Echo / Phillips Hue

            Adapter: Fritzbox, Tankerkönig, Cloud Adapter</size>

            1 Antwort Letzte Antwort
            0
            • C Offline
              C Offline
              chka
              schrieb am zuletzt editiert von
              #71

              in die quelle darf nur die url ohne die html tacks

              INTEL NUC BOXNUC6I3SYH i3-6100U - Proxmox

              Speicher: Transcend MTS800 M.2 SSD 128GB SATA III, MLC

              RAM: 40Gig Crucial 8GB DDR4 CT2K8G4SFS824A + 32GB DDR4CT32G4SFD8266

              1 Antwort Letzte Antwort
              0
              • N Offline
                N Offline
                Nebulus
                schrieb am zuletzt editiert von
                #72

                Danke für den Versuch,

                verstehe ich leider nicht.

                <size size="85">Pi1: Raspberrymatic / Pi2: Jessie, ioBroker Amazon Echo / Phillips Hue

                Adapter: Fritzbox, Tankerkönig, Cloud Adapter</size>

                1 Antwort Letzte Antwort
                0
                • C Offline
                  C Offline
                  chka
                  schrieb am zuletzt editiert von
                  #73

                  du darfst in das Feld quelle nur https://www.google….. eintragen nicht<iframe ...</r=""></iframe>

                  INTEL NUC BOXNUC6I3SYH i3-6100U - Proxmox

                  Speicher: Transcend MTS800 M.2 SSD 128GB SATA III, MLC

                  RAM: 40Gig Crucial 8GB DDR4 CT2K8G4SFS824A + 32GB DDR4CT32G4SFD8266

                  1 Antwort Letzte Antwort
                  0
                  • ruhr70R Offline
                    ruhr70R Offline
                    ruhr70
                    schrieb am zuletzt editiert von Jey Cee
                    #74

                    @nyandog:

                    Hallo!

                    Leider scheint das Script bei mir irgendwie nicht zu funktionieren. Ich habe die Wegpunkte und meinen Google API-Key eingetragen und bekomme im Log folgendes zurück:

                    ` > 11:29:40.310 [info] javascript.0 Start javascript script.js.stau.stau_zur_arbeit

                    11:29:40.310 [info] javascript.0 script.js.stau.stau_zur_arbeit: registered 0 subscriptions and 1 schedule

                    11:29:41.693 [info] javascript.0 script.js.stau.stau_zur_arbeit: Kein gültiger Status Google Maps: NOT_FOUND

                    Erst einmal willkommen im Forum! 🙂

                    Hier gab es das schon einmal:

                    viewtopic.php?f=8&t=4019&start=40#p53115

                    Da war es ein Fehler bei den Koordinaten.

                    @nyandog:

                    Wenn ich die URL direkt im Browser eingebe, bekomme ich folgendes zurück:
                    ` > {

                    "geocoded_waypoints" : [

                    {

                    "geocoder_status" : "ZERO_RESULTS"

                    },

                    {

                    "geocoder_status" : "ZERO_RESULTS"

                    },

                    {

                    "geocoder_status" : "ZERO_RESULTS"

                    }

                    ],

                    "routes" : [],

                    "status" : "NOT_FOUND"

                    } `

                    Am Script selbst habe ich nichts verändert. Hat jemand eine Idee, woran es liegen könnte? `

                    Was heißt nichts verändert?

                    Die Koordinaten, die hier im Forum standen?

                    Das sind nur Phantasiezahlen, um die echte Adresse nicht im WWW zu veröffentlichen.

                    Du musst Deine Koordinaten ermitteln und diese eintragen.

                    Welches Skript hast Du denn verwendet?

                    Kannst DU den Beitrag mit dem Skript posten?

                    Adapter: Fritzbox, Unify Circuit
                    Skripte: dynamic hue, Bluetooth Scan, Multi-Ereignisliste

                    1 Antwort Letzte Antwort
                    0
                    • N Offline
                      N Offline
                      Nebulus
                      schrieb am zuletzt editiert von
                      #75

                      Klasse hat geklappt, besten Dank

                      <size size="85">Pi1: Raspberrymatic / Pi2: Jessie, ioBroker Amazon Echo / Phillips Hue

                      Adapter: Fritzbox, Tankerkönig, Cloud Adapter</size>

                      1 Antwort Letzte Antwort
                      0
                      • N Offline
                        N Offline
                        nyandog
                        schrieb am zuletzt editiert von
                        #76

                        ` > @ruhr70:

                        @nyandog:

                        Hallo!

                        Leider scheint das Script bei mir irgendwie nicht zu funktionieren. Ich habe die Wegpunkte und meinen Google API-Key eingetragen und bekomme im Log folgendes zurück:

                        Erst einmal willkommen im Forum! 🙂

                        Hier gab es das schon einmal:

                        viewtopic.php?f=8&t=4019&start=40#p53115

                        Da war es ein Fehler bei den Koordinaten. `

                        Danke für die schnelle Antwort! 🙂

                        Peinlicherweise war es wirklich ein Fehler bei den Koordinaten. Dort hatte sich ein Komma zu viel eingeschlichen. Jetzt funktioniert es! 🙂

                        1 Antwort Letzte Antwort
                        0
                        • D Offline
                          D Offline
                          Dice19
                          schrieb am zuletzt editiert von
                          #77

                          HI,

                          habe das Script kopiert und habe das Zeit im Script "zur_Arbeit" geändert auf zur_ArbeitHavelse" da das meine 2te Route ist.

                          Das erste Script funktioniert ohne Probleme in den Objekten nur das zweite geänderte zeigt keine Werte an.

                          Brauche ich eine zweite api dafür oder muss ich noch etwas ändern?

                          Was mir aufgefallen ist unter Objekten steht auch nicht Abfrage Google Ok etc.

                          Habe auch unter Objekten mal alles von Google Maps Eintrag gelöscht das er alles neu angelegt aber beim 2ten geänderten ändert sich nichts.
                          2120_fehler_script_verkehr.png

                          1 Antwort Letzte Antwort
                          0
                          • C Offline
                            C Offline
                            chka
                            schrieb am zuletzt editiert von
                            #78

                            du hast in deinem script in Zeile 230 irgendwas falsch

                            INTEL NUC BOXNUC6I3SYH i3-6100U - Proxmox

                            Speicher: Transcend MTS800 M.2 SSD 128GB SATA III, MLC

                            RAM: 40Gig Crucial 8GB DDR4 CT2K8G4SFS824A + 32GB DDR4CT32G4SFD8266

                            1 Antwort Letzte Antwort
                            0
                            • U Offline
                              U Offline
                              Unkn0wnUser
                              schrieb am zuletzt editiert von
                              #79

                              Funktioniert einwandfrei! Ich habe die aktuelle Wegzeit nun als Basis genommen um zu berechnen, wann ich spätestens losfahren muss um pünktlich in der Arbeit zu sein. Das ganze mit einer Weckfunktion gekoppelt und man kann trotz Schneechaos immer pünktlich vor Ort sein (oder auch mal ein wenig länger schlafen, da die Wegzeit alle 10 Minuten überprüft wird..)! 🙂

                              Edit: Dazu habe ich einmal selbst ein detailliertes Tutorial geschrieben, welches Ihr https://www.intech-blog.de/wegzeitberechnung-zwischen-zwei-orten findet!

                              1 Antwort Letzte Antwort
                              0
                              • N Offline
                                N Offline
                                nousefor82
                                schrieb am zuletzt editiert von
                                #80

                                Vielen Dank für die tolle Arbeit!

                                @Unkn0wnUser: Super Anleitung auf deiner HP, vielen Dank auch dafür!

                                VG

                                Jörg

                                1 Antwort Letzte Antwort
                                0
                                • 0 Offline
                                  0 Offline
                                  0018
                                  schrieb am zuletzt editiert von
                                  #81

                                  Ich habe jetzt nach ca 1 Wocher laufzeit mal bei meiner Google API ÜBersicht geschaut und bei der Übersicht "Abrechnung" stehen aktuell Kosten in Höhe von 10,36€. Ist das bei euch auch so? Dachte die Nutzung wäre kostenlos? Oder habe ich was falsch eingerichtet?

                                  1620_maps.png

                                  Mfg
                                  0018

                                  1 Antwort Letzte Antwort
                                  0
                                  • Jeeper.atJ Offline
                                    Jeeper.atJ Offline
                                    Jeeper.at
                                    schrieb am zuletzt editiert von
                                    #82

                                    Die Nutzung kostet. Allerdings gibt es eine monatliche Gutschrift in der Höhe von 200.-

                                    Deshalb ist nur diese Nutzung defacto kostenlos.

                                    1 Antwort Letzte Antwort
                                    0
                                    • K Offline
                                      K Offline
                                      Karl_999
                                      schrieb am zuletzt editiert von
                                      #83

                                      Siehe auch viewtopic.php?f=8&t=13905&p=150810

                                      1 Antwort Letzte Antwort
                                      0
                                      • ruhr70R ruhr70

                                        @hobbyquaker:

                                        @ruhr70:

                                        früher konnte man mit dem kostenlosen api key von google über die Webschnittstellenicht die Stauzeiten abfragen. Habe es vor ein paar Wochen wieder versucht (per Script). Die Zeiten wechseln zwar, aber nur leicht und nicht so, wie bei Google Maps `

                                        ich frag die Fahrzeiten nach wie vor bei Google ab. Gibt bei mir realistische Ergebnisse aus. Man muss nur eines beachten: Es reicht nicht aus einfach nur Origin und Destination in die Abfrage zu packen, dann wird der Verkehr nicht (richtig?) berücksichtigt. Man muss eine Zwischenstation ("waypoint") mit einbauen, diese kann aber die gleichen Koordinaten haben wie die Destination. Warum auch immer, das weiss wohl nur Google 😉 `

                                        Danke!

                                        Funktioniert jetzt auch. Zwischenstation habe ich eingefügt, allerdings nicht getestet, ob der Schritt notwendig ist.

                                        Grundlegender Fehler bei mir war, dass ich duration.text verwendet habe und nicht duration_in.text :shock: :oops:

                                        327_google_maps.jpg

                                        Die Zwischenstation habe ich mittendrin gewählt, damit auch immer die gleiche Route ausgewertet wird. Die Koordinaten für die Zwischenstation erhält man sauber, wenn man einmal das JSON erzeugen lässt, ohne Zwischenstation.

                                        Danke noch einmal 🙂

                                        327_google_maps_2.jpg

                                        O Online
                                        O Online
                                        Oli
                                        schrieb am zuletzt editiert von
                                        #84

                                        Hallo @ruhr70 und all den anderen hier,

                                        ich muss das Thema nochmals hervorholen, da ich noch eine frage zum Script habe.

                                        Erstmal vielen Dank für die Arbeit, die ihr hier alle leistet, ist echt klasse von euch.

                                        Das script funktioniert super!!

                                        Nur würde mich interessieren, ob und wie es möglich ist, die Abfragezeit in einen Datenpunkt zu schreiben?

                                        Ich bin in Javascript schreiben ein Neuling, also entschuldigt die Anfängerfrage.

                                        Gruß Oliver

                                        Gruß
                                        Oliver

                                        1 Antwort Letzte Antwort
                                        0
                                        • R Offline
                                          R Offline
                                          ReverZ
                                          schrieb am zuletzt editiert von
                                          #85

                                          Mittlerweile scheint es so zu sein, dass ohne hinterlegte Zahlungsmöglichkeiten gerade mal eine handvoll API-Aufrufe möglich sind (vielleicht 8 am Tag?)
                                          Google gibt aktuell an, dass die 200$-Gutschrift für ca. 40000 Aufrufe reichen.
                                          Mich würde mal interessieren wie ihr das handhabt!?
                                          Gebt ihr einfach eure Kreditkartendaten an, habt ihr evtl. eine eigene Kreditkarte dafür angelegt oder gibt es noch andere Möglichkeiten, die Datenkrake nicht unnötig stark mit personenbezogenen Daten zu füttern?

                                          1 Antwort Letzte Antwort
                                          0
                                          Antworten
                                          • In einem neuen Thema antworten
                                          Anmelden zum Antworten
                                          • Älteste zuerst
                                          • Neuste zuerst
                                          • Meiste Stimmen


                                          Support us

                                          ioBroker
                                          Community Adapters
                                          Donate
                                          FAQ Cloud / IOT
                                          HowTo: Node.js-Update
                                          HowTo: Backup/Restore
                                          Downloads
                                          BLOG

                                          711

                                          Online

                                          32.4k

                                          Benutzer

                                          81.4k

                                          Themen

                                          1.3m

                                          Beiträge
                                          Community
                                          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                          ioBroker Community 2014-2025
                                          logo
                                          • Anmelden

                                          • Du hast noch kein Konto? Registrieren

                                          • Anmelden oder registrieren, um zu suchen
                                          • Erster Beitrag
                                            Letzter Beitrag
                                          0
                                          • Aktuell
                                          • Tags
                                          • Ungelesen 0
                                          • Kategorien
                                          • Unreplied
                                          • Beliebt
                                          • GitHub
                                          • Docu
                                          • Hilfe